Essential Job Functions

The VP of Development provides leadership for, strategizes and directs fund-raising activities and programs for ZNE including individual gifts, planned giving, corporate and foundation grants and capital campaigns. In addition is responsible for developing and implementing fully-integrated annual and long-term fundraising and sponsorship plans that in addition to increasing philanthropic and sponsorship support, supports increasesinattendance and earned revenues. The Vice President of Development also serves as a member of ZNE’s senior management team, which oversees all aspects of ZNE’s operations.

As an Executive Team member, the Vice President of Development assists in the establishment and execution of annual institutional goals, business and master plans, supports departmental objectives, institutional policies and procedures, customer service development and training, budget development and management.
